How EDG Numbers Organize SNAP Payments
The EDG number helps to effectively organize SNAP payments for qualifying families:
- Each household must be assigned a unique EDG number, which is given as per the SNAP eligibility confirmation.
- The payment dates are given as per the final two digits of the household’s EDG number.
- EDG numbers make sure that there is a smooth distribution of SNAP funds.
- This system will eliminate overcrowding and ensure that scheduled payments are accurate.

SNAP Payment Schedule (Dec 25-28, 2025)
The final week of SNAP December SNAP payments in the city of Texas, which are given as the last two digits of the household EDG number:
| Date | EDG numbers |
|---|---|
| December 22 | 75-78 |
| December 23 | 79-81 |
| December 24 | 82-85 |
| December 25 | 86-88 |
| December 26 | 89-92 |
| December 27 | 93-95 |
| December 28 | 96-99 |
Spending Rules for SNAP Payments
The recipients of SNAP benefits are subject to specific restrictions on the items they can purchase:
- Purchases of alcohol as well as tobacco products are specifically excluded from SNAP benefits.
- SNAP funds won’t get utilized to clear any unpaid food debt balance.
- From April 2026 on, sugary treats, such as chocolate-coated fruit, candy bars, and chewing gum, will be restricted.
- Drinks that have a significant amount of added sugar or artificial sweeteners, such as 5 grams or more, will no longer qualify.
- These refreshed regulations are designed to help applicants to choose the wholesome and healthful selections.
